22. The County Commissioners of the several counties of
|
missioners of
the counties
|
this State, and the Mayor and City Council of Baltimore are
|
of the State
|
directed to levy the State taxes to be collected according to
|
directed to
levy the State
|
law and to be apportioned for the year 1904 as follows: a tax
|
taxes, etc.,
for 1904.
|
of fifteen cents on each one hundred dollars to aid in support
|
 
|
of the public schools to be distributed according to law among
|
 
|
the several counties and City of Baltimore; a tax of one and
|
 
|
three-fourths of one cent on each one hundred dollars to defray
|
 
|
the costs of supplying books for the use of the children in the
|
 
|
public schools of this State ; a tax of one-half of one cent on
|
 
|
each one hundred dollars to meet the interest and create a
|
 
|
sinking fund for the redemption of the Penitentiary loan ; a
|
 
|
tax of one-eighth of one cent on each one hundred dollars to
|
 
|
meet the interest and create a sinking fund for the redemption
|
 
|
of the Insane Asylum loan; a tax of one-half of one cent on
|
 
|
each one hundred dollars to meet the interest and create a
|
 
|
sinking fund for the State Building and Improvement Loan ;
|
 
|
a tax of two and seven-eighths cents on each one hundred dol-
|
 
|
lars to meet the interest and create a sinking fund for the re-
|
 
|
demption of the Consolidated Loan of 1899; a tax of three-
|
 
|
fourths of one cent on each one hundred dollars to meet the
|
 
|
interest and create a sinking fund for the redemption of the
|
 
|
State Loan of 1902 ; and a tax of one cent on each one hundred
|
 
|
dollars to meet the interest and create a sinking fund for the
|
 
|
redemption of the Public Buildings Loan, making an aggregate
|
 
|
of twenty-two and one-half cents on each one hundred dollars ;
|
 
|
and the Comptroller of the Treasury shall levy the same State
|
 
|
taxes on the shares of capital stock of all banks, State and
|
 
|
national, and other incorporated institutions and companies of
|
 
|
this State, the shares of whose capital stock are liable by law
|
 
|
to assessment and taxation. The County Commissioners of
|
 
|
the several counties of this State and the Mayor and City
|
 
|
Council of Baltimore are directed to levy the State taxes to
